lxc: drop compat code for clone constants
Given our supported platform matrix, we can safely assume that all the clone constants we need are defined by the system headers. Reviewed-by: Pavel Hrdina <phrdina@redhat.com> Signed-off-by: Daniel P. Berrangé <berrange@redhat.com>
